Concepts You Need to Know
Backdoor Roth IRA
A strategy for high earners who exceed Roth IRA income limits. You contribute to a traditional IRA (non-deductible) and then convert it to Roth. Legal, widely used, but requires careful tax tracking.
Tax diversification
Holding assets in three buckets: taxable (brokerage), tax-deferred (401k/IRA), and tax-free (Roth/IUL). This gives flexibility to manage your tax rate in retirement.
Cash value life insurance as an asset
Permanent policies (IUL/whole life) accumulate cash value that grows tax-deferred and can be accessed tax-free via loans. Often used as a "bank" to fund investments or emergencies.
